Tyler, MN Radon Mitigation and Testing
Found in Lincoln County along Minnesota's southwestern border with South Dakota, Tyler sits within the prairie pothole region where glacial till over limestone bedrock can contribute to elevated radon potential. Most homes in this farming community were built during the mid-20th century with full basements designed to handle the area's harsh winters. Given the absence of comprehensive radon testing data for zip code 56178, local residents should prioritize home testing to assess their specific radon risk.

Tyler Radon Facts
Key details about the radon risk profile for Tyler and the 56178 zip code area.
Tyler and the 56178 zip code are located in Lincoln County, which has an EPA assigned Radon Zone of 1. A radon zone of 1 predicts an average indoor radon screening level greater than 4 pCi/L. The EPA recommends testing every home regardless of zone classification.
